Charlotte E. Larson

Nov 8, 1925 – Jun 14, 2021

Service Details

After cremation, Charlotte’s remains will be placed at Graceland Cemetery with her parents.

Racine – Charlotte E. Larson passed away at the age of 95 in Ridgewood Care Center, Racine, WI on Monday, June 14, 2021. She was born in 1925 to Anna Louise (Harnish) and Charles Lowry Ingles.

Charlotte was married to Edwin E. Larson Jr. for 32 years. They had five girls: Patricia (John) Swiencicki, Winneconne, WI; Anna Shauck, Red Oak, TX; Doris (Larry) Hawkes, Townsend, DE; Deborah (Stanley) Nicikowski, Racine, WI; Sharon (Scott) Larson-Wohlgemth, Racine, WI; 13 grandchildren, 25 great-grandchildren, and 2 great great-grandchildren Olivia and Eleanor Coutts, St. Paul, MN.

Charlotte was preceded in death by her parents and seven siblings: Charles, Robert, William, Anna Fulmer, Hazel Haigh, Florence Noonan, and Alice Platt. 

May God comfort all who mourn.
